EWC 2026: Massive Prizes Meet Steady Growth
The Esports World Cup (EWC) just dropped a bombshell: a whopping $75 million prize pool for 2026. But heres the real MVP story—organizers are laser-focused on financial sustainability. EWCF COO Mike McCabe assured everyone theyre on track for 2030 goals, thanks to booming ticket sales, sponsorships, and merch revenue. No more feast-or-famine; this non-profit foundation is building a stable empire. Picture clubs investing in players year after year, crowned as ultimate cross-game champs. Fortnite and Trackmania are locked in for multiple editions, giving teams roster-building confidence. After 2025s 750 million viewers, EWC is proving big spectacles can pay dividends without burning out.
Monetization Makeover: Fair Play Wins
In the wider gaming scene, companies are ditching shady pay-to-win tricks for transparent models. Value-based battle passes and cosmetic sales build trust, like a reliable teammate who always has your back. Experts say this shift ties directly to player retention and steady revenue streams. Businesses thriving in 2026? Those balancing profit with fairness, using secure payments to boost lifetime value.
